ARISD Auto Paintless Dent Repair Kit.Large dents require filling and paint, since the metal deforms. A talented sheet metal worker can fix a dent without fill, but it is not cost effective in most cases. Paintless dent removal experts can fix small dents with hand tools for $100 or so, but only if they aren't along body lines or creases in the panel. Lightly pound the dent out with a mallet: Remove the hood, lay it upside down on a blanket, then lightly pound against the periphery of the dent. Work your way toward the center until it pops back into place. Pop the dent with a plunger: Some simple dents can be popped out using a household plunger or dent puller kit. How to fix a dent using the glue and puller method: Clean the surface. Heat up the glue/glue gun. Apply a small blob of glue directly onto the panel. Press in one of the plastic tabs. Allow to cool completely. Attach a puller or a slide hammer. I am applying pressure, pulling my slide hammer to pull the dent out whilst with ...Step 2: Use a Plunger or Suction Cup Dent Puller. For shallow dents without any creases, a plunger or suction cup dent puller is a simple and effective solution. Moisten the plunger or suction cup and place it over the dent. Push down and then pull up, creating a vacuum that should pop the dent out.
